A RESOLUTION
Recognizing the month of October 2020 as "Italian-American
Heritage Month" in Pennsylvania.
WHEREAS, Italian Americans have contributed to a great number
of aspects of our everyday life in the United States; and
WHEREAS, Italian explorer Christopher Columbus has been
credited with accidentally stumbling upon the Americas on one of
his journeys, resulting in centuries of explorations on the
American continent; and
WHEREAS, Shortly after Christopher Columbus journeyed to
America, the terms "America" and "Americas" were derived from
the Italian merchant, explorer and navigator, Amerigo Vespucci;
and
WHEREAS, Italian Filippo Mazzei, a promoter of liberty,
became a close friend of Thomas Jefferson and published a
pamphlet containing the phrase "All men are by nature equally
free and independent"; and
WHEREAS, It was not until the 1820s that Italian immigrants
began moving to the United States in sizable numbers; and
